Specifications and features include:

  • Windows 10 Mobile with Continuum support (via dock), Display Dock included in some markets
  • 2″ Quad HD AMOLED display of 564ppi, ClearBlack technology, Glance Screen; Gorilla Glass 3
  • Snapdragon 808: hexa-core processor with 2x 1.82GHz Cortex-A57 and 4x 1.44GHz Cortex -A53, Adreno 418 GPU, 3GB of RAM
  • 20MP BSI PureView camera sensor, ZEISS optics, optical image stabilization, tri-LED RGB flash, Rich Capture, RAW capture, Dynamic Flash, lossless zoom in the 8MP snaps, 50MP panoramic shots
  • 2160p video recording @30, 25 and 24 fps, 1080p video recording @ 60, 30, 25 and 24 fps; slow-mo capturing; Rich Audio Recording with four-directional microphones, lossless zoom in 1080p (3x) and 720p (4x) videos.
  • 5MP front-facing camera with 1080p@30fps video recording
  • 32GB of built-in storage; expandable via a microSD slot
  • 6 LTE (300/50Mbps); Dual SIM; Wi-Fi a/b/g/n/ac; Bluetooth 4.1; GPS/GLONASS/Beidou; USB Type-C port
  • Windows Hello user recognition with iris scanner
  • Active noise cancellation via dedicated mics
  • 3,000mAh battery with wireless charging (market-dependent)
